St. Paulinus, Cray St Paul, Kent

Description

The church of St. Paulinus is of flint and stone, chiefly in the Early English style, and has a tower with spire containing 3 bells: several of the windows are stained, two being memorials: the Churchyard affords fine views over the surrounding landscape: there are 300 sittings.

Church Records

The oldest parish register dates from the year 1579.
